‘Black Doves’ Adds Neve Campbell, Ambika Mod, Babou Ceesay & More Stars to Season 2 Cast
Black Doves is gearing up for Season 2 as the Netflix series adds more stars to its ensemble. Several other famous faces are set to join Keira Knightley and Ben Whishaw, who are returning for the latest chapter.
Along with the recent casting news, Netflix has also announced that production is underway for Season 2 of Black Doves in London. Who stars in Black Doves Season 2?

As mentioned above, Keira Knightley and Ben Whishaw will both be back as Helen and Sam, reuniting onscreen with Sarah Lancashire‘s Mrs. Reed and Andrew Buchan‘s Wallace, with Season 1’s Kathryn Hunter, Ella Lily Hyland, Gabrielle Creevy, Agnes O’Casey, and Molly Chesworth all returning. Meanwhile, Season 2 will welcome new additions Ambika Mod as Laila, Babou Ceesay as Mr. Conteh, Sam Riley as Patrick, Neve Campbell as Cecile Mason, Sylvia Hoeks as Katia Chernov, Goran Kostic as Alexi Chernov, and Samuel Barnett as Jerry.
What is Black Doves Season 2 about?
Season 2 of Black Doves sees Helen (Knightley) still betraying her nation’s secret to the covert organization she serves, known as the Black Doves. After last Christmas’s misadventures, though, and her husband Wallace’s (Buchan) preparations to become Prime Minister, Helen’s carving an even more treacherous path. Meanwhile, Helen’s handler, Mrs. Reed (Lancashire), is ensnared in a plot to undermine her position in the Black Doves, and Helen is reunited with her best friend, Sam (Whishaw). As the pals search for answers, their loyalties are tested, and trust is shattered as they fight to protect their loved ones.
Series creator Joe Barton teased in a statement, “I couldn’t be more excited to delve back into the world of our murderous little spy family. To have so many of our amazing cast returning and also being able to add some of my absolute favourite actors into the mix is such a great joy. Downing Street will never be the same again…”
Who makes Black Doves Season 2?
Black Doves is created and written by Joe Barton, who executive produces the series alongside Jane Featherstone, Chris Fry, and Keira Knightley. Meanwhile, episodes are directed by Julian Farino and Kieron Hawkes, with Callum Devrell-Cameron serving as a producer.
